How Google Search Works (Simplified)

To understand SEO for beginners, you need to know how Google works behind the scenes. There are three main stages involved in how search engines process websites: crawling, indexing, and ranking. These three steps determine whether your website can appear in search results and how visible it becomes over time.

1. Crawling

Google uses automated bots, also called crawlers or spiders, to scan the internet and discover new or updated web pages. If your website has poor navigation or broken internal links, those bots may struggle to find all your important content. That is one reason internal linking matters in SEO for beginners.

2. Indexing

After Google discovers your page, it stores that page in a huge database called the index. If your page is not indexed, it cannot appear in search results. Technical issues, duplicate content, or thin content can affect indexing, which is why technical SEO is an essential part of SEO for beginners.

3. Ranking

When someone searches for something, Google ranks pages based on relevance to the query, the quality of the content, and the overall website experience. Search engines want to serve the best result possible. That is why SEO for beginners is really about proving that your page deserves to be shown.

SEO Basics Every Beginner Must Understand

Keywords Explained Simply

Keywords are the words and phrases people type into Google when searching for information, products, or services. Understanding keywords is one of the most important parts of SEO for beginners because keywords tell you what your audience actually wants. If you guess wrong, your content may never attract the right traffic.

Examples of keywords include “SEO for beginners,” “affordable SEO services in Kenya,” and “SEO expert near me.” There are two common types of keywords. Short-tail keywords are broad and highly competitive, such as “SEO.” Long-tail keywords are more specific and usually easier to rank for, such as “SEO services for small businesses in Kenya.”

For most businesses, long-tail phrases are the best starting point in SEO for beginners because they often bring more targeted users who already know what they want. To learn how to find the right terms, read our Keyword Research Guide.

On-Page SEO: Optimizing Your Website Pages

On-page SEO refers to everything you do within your website to improve rankings. This includes titles, meta descriptions, headings, URLs, internal links, keyword placement, and image optimization. For many businesses, on-page work is the fastest practical part of SEO for beginners because you can improve it directly on your own pages.

SEO Titles and Meta Descriptions

Your title is one of the most important on-page ranking factors. Best practice in SEO for beginners is to include your keyword naturally, keep the title under about 60 characters where possible, and make it compelling enough to earn clicks. A strong example is the one used in this article: SEO for Beginners: How to Rank on the First Page of Google.

Meta descriptions do not directly guarantee rankings, but they can improve click-through rate. A good meta description summarizes the page, encourages the user to click, and includes the keyword naturally. Strong titles and descriptions make your content more competitive in search results.

Headings (H1, H2, H3)

Headings help both users and search engines understand your content. In SEO for beginners, use one H1 per page, then organize sections with H2 and H3 headings. This improves readability, makes your page easier to scan, and helps Google interpret your structure more clearly.

Keyword Placement

To optimize properly, place your keyword in the title, within the first 100 words, in relevant headings, in image alt text, and in the URL where appropriate. But avoid keyword stuffing. The goal in SEO for beginners is natural placement, not forcing the same phrase into every sentence. Write for humans first, then refine for search.

Image Optimization for SEO

Images improve user experience, but they must be optimized. Use descriptive file names such as seo-ranking-kenya.jpg, compress images for faster loading, and add relevant alt text. This helps both accessibility and search visibility. Image optimization is a small but valuable part of SEO for beginners because it supports speed and page quality at the same time.

Technical SEO Basics (Beginner-Friendly)

Technical SEO ensures your website functions properly and is easy for Google to crawl. Many people think technical SEO is too advanced, but the beginner version is very manageable. In fact, ignoring it can hold back all your other progress. That is why it is a core part of SEO for beginners.

  • Website speed: Slow websites lose visitors and often rank lower.
  • Mobile-friendly design: Most users in Kenya browse on phones, so your site must work perfectly on mobile.
  • Secure website (HTTPS): Google prefers secure websites.
  • Clean URLs: A page like yourwebsite.com/seo-for-beginners is better than a messy parameter-based URL.

Even if your content is great, poor technical setup can prevent your website from ranking. Think of technical SEO as the foundation. If the foundation is weak, your SEO for beginners efforts will struggle to perform. For a deeper breakdown, visit our Technical SEO Guide.

Off-Page SEO: Building Authority

Off-page SEO focuses on building your website’s credibility beyond your own site. A key part of this is backlinks, which are links from other websites pointing to yours. In SEO for beginners, backlinks can be understood as signals of trust. If reputable websites link to your content, Google may view your site as more authoritative.

Safe ways to earn backlinks in Kenya include submitting your business to quality directories, writing guest blog posts, partnering with other businesses, and sharing useful content on social media. Avoid spammy backlinks or suspicious link schemes. Those can do more harm than good. A clean and steady backlink strategy supports long-term growth in SEO for beginners.

Local SEO: Ranking for “Near Me” Searches in Kenya

Local SEO helps your business appear when people search for nearby services. For many service-based businesses, this is one of the most commercially valuable parts of SEO for beginners. Searches such as “SEO services near me,” “SEO company in Nairobi,” or “digital marketing agency in Kenya” show strong buying intent.

To improve local SEO, create and optimize your Google Business Profile, add your business name, address, and phone number consistently, use location-based keywords in your content, encourage customer reviews, and submit your business to trusted local directories. If your business serves multiple areas, location pages can be a strong asset.

Local SEO is especially powerful in Kenya because many users want providers they can trust within their area. That is why SEO for beginners should always include a local strategy where relevant. For more depth, see our Local SEO Kenya Guide.
